What Actually Changes When You Leave GamStop

Non GamStop casinos operate under international licenses-Curacao, Panama, the Kahnawake Gaming Commission-not the UK Gambling Commission. That shift in regulator is the root of almost every difference. The rules on bonuses loosen up. The game libraries bulk up. Payment methods like crypto and e-wallets become the norm rather than the exception. You get faster access to new game releases and higher betting limits. But you also trade the UKGC’s rigorous consumer protections for a system where dispute resolution depends heavily on the license holder’s reputation.

How to Pick a Good One (Because Not All Are Equal)

Not every international casino is built to last. Some have terrible customer support. Others hide punishing clauses in their bonus terms. You need a filter.

  1. Verify the license. A Curacao eGaming license is common-check the number on the official registry.
  2. Test the support. Drop a question in live chat. If you get a bot or a 10-minute wait, walk away.
  3. Read the bonus terms. Ignore the flashy percentage. Look at the wagering requirement and max cashout.
  4. Check the withdrawal limits. Some casinos cap monthly withdrawals. Make sure the limits match your style.
